Following up on the release of One Piece Season 2: Into the Grand Line last month, Netflix had three big new announcements for fans of the One Piece franchise this week. The streaming platform announced a title for Season 3 of the One Piece live-action adaptation, an all-new LEGO One Piece special, and a closer look at WIT Studio’s The One Piece anime.

When is One Piece Season 3 coming out on Netflix?

Netflix confirmed this week that Season 2 of its One Piece live-action adaptation has been a “massive success,” debuting at #1 on its Global Top 10 list with positive reviews. Thus, it’s “officially opening the hatches, drawing from the original source material for fans to experience this beloved world and its iconic characters in new ways.”

That begins with Season 3 of One Piece, entitled One Piece: The Battle of Alabasta. This season will see the Straw Hat Pirates head into Princess Vivi’s homeland of Alabasta. Here’s Netflix’s synopsis for the upcoming season:

"In this upcoming season, war is coming for Monkey D. Luffy and the Straw Hat crew in the desert kingdom of Alabasta, Princess Vivi’s homeland. A rebellion threatens to tear the nation apart, fueled in secret by one of the Seven Warlords of the Sea, the ruthless Sir Crocodile, and his underground syndicate Baroque Works, who seek to conquer Alabasta for themselves. 

“In a season defined by unbreakable bonds and impossible choices, the Straw Hats must face a brewing civil war and a powerful warlord to save Vivi’s kingdom before it crumbles into the sand. Fans can look forward to formidable new enemies and brand-new worlds where the stakes have never been higher.”

Season 3 looks to adapt a war story, which might set it apart from the multi-story structure of Season 2. 

What is the LEGO One Piece animated special?

In an arguably more surprising reveal, Netflix also confirmed that a LEGO One Piece animated special is now in development, and is planned for release on 29 September, 2026. Here’s a trailer:

The animated special is produced by the LEGO Group, Shueisha, and Atomic, and is described as “the perfect entryway for new recruits and an exciting new perspective for veteran pirates.”

When is WIT Studio’s The One Piece anime coming out?

WIT Studio’s upcoming anime adaptation of the One Piece manga serves to retell the original anime’s story with less filler content. The anime, entitled “The One Piece,” was originally announced all the way back in December 2023, but has given few updates since. 

This week, that changed. Netflix showed off a closer look at the anime’s character designs for the Straw Hats, including Luffy, Nami, Zoro, and Usopp. The video did not give much else away regarding the anime, which suggests that it’s still far from release at this time. 

The One Piece is in production at WIT Studio, in collaboration with Shueisha, Toei Animation and Fuji Television Network, reimagining the iconic East Blue saga. The anime still does not have a release date.
